图书类型 增加全部选择项
This commit is contained in:
@@ -115,8 +115,14 @@ public class ShopProductLabelController {
|
|||||||
if (type!=null){
|
if (type!=null){
|
||||||
wrapper.leftJoin(MedicaldesBook.class, MedicaldesBook::getBookId,ShopProduct::getBookId);
|
wrapper.leftJoin(MedicaldesBook.class, MedicaldesBook::getBookId,ShopProduct::getBookId);
|
||||||
wrapper.inSql(ShopProduct::getProductId,"select product_id from shop_product where book_Ids not like \"%,%\"");
|
wrapper.inSql(ShopProduct::getProductId,"select product_id from shop_product where book_Ids not like \"%,%\"");
|
||||||
|
if(type==0){//0为医学图书全部
|
||||||
|
wrapper.in(MedicaldesBook::getTypeId,1,2,3,4);
|
||||||
|
}else if (type == -1) {//-1为文哲图书全部
|
||||||
|
wrapper.in(MedicaldesBook::getTypeId,5,6);
|
||||||
|
}else {
|
||||||
wrapper.eq(MedicaldesBook::getTypeId,type);
|
wrapper.eq(MedicaldesBook::getTypeId,type);
|
||||||
}
|
}
|
||||||
|
}
|
||||||
Page<ShopProduct> shopProductEntityPage = shopProductToLabelDao.selectJoinPage(new Page<ShopProduct>(page, limit),
|
Page<ShopProduct> shopProductEntityPage = shopProductToLabelDao.selectJoinPage(new Page<ShopProduct>(page, limit),
|
||||||
ShopProduct.class, wrapper);
|
ShopProduct.class, wrapper);
|
||||||
return R.ok().put("page",shopProductEntityPage);
|
return R.ok().put("page",shopProductEntityPage);
|
||||||
|
|||||||
Reference in New Issue
Block a user